How To Fix PTRA_DIALOGUE018 - No retroactive run: "Earliest master data change" < retro accounting date


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: PTRA_DIALOGUE - HR TRAVEL: Messages for Trip Costs Dialog

  • Message number: 018

  • Message text: No retroactive run: "Earliest master data change" < retro accounting date

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message PTRA_DIALOGUE018 - No retroactive run: "Earliest master data change" < retro accounting date ?

    The SAP error message PTRA_DIALOGUE018, which states "No retroactive run: 'Earliest master data change' < retro accounting date," typically occurs in the context of payroll processing when there are changes to master data (such as employee information) that affect payroll calculations. This error indicates that there is an attempt to perform a retroactive payroll run, but the earliest change in the master data is earlier than the retroactive accounting date specified in the payroll run.

    Cause:

    1. Master Data Changes: There have been changes to employee master data (e.g., salary changes, position changes, etc.) that are effective from a date earlier than the retroactive accounting date.
    2. Retroactive Accounting Date: The retroactive accounting date is set to a date that does not encompass the period of the master data changes. This means that the system cannot process the changes because they fall outside the specified retroactive period.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check Master Data Changes:

      • Review the employee's master data changes to identify the effective dates of any changes.
      • Ensure that the retroactive accounting date is set to a date that includes all relevant master data changes.
    2. Adjust Retroactive Accounting Date:

      • If necessary, adjust the retroactive accounting date to a date that is on or before the earliest master data change. This will allow the system to process the retroactive payroll run correctly.
    3. Run Payroll Again:

      • After making the necessary adjustments, re-run the payroll process to see if the error persists.
